As temperatures drop this winter, many of our neighbors living on the streets of the San Francisco Peninsula are left vulnerable to the harsh elements. Without proper protection from the cold, they face life-threatening risks, including hypothermia, worsened medical conditions, and a deeper struggle with addiction.
Nearly a quarter of all unhoused Americans live in California, and this year, the state’s homeless population has grown by another 3%. Many of these individuals are battling not just homelessness but the cold, damp nights that take a physical and emotional toll
